I am not deep south, but we also have a fall crop-winter season here for brassicas. So far so good. Got several broccoli and cauliflower to head and harvested them and so far no freezes hard enough to kill the collards, brussel sprouts or spring cauliflower. (We have two types of cauliflower here. One likes to head up in late fall after the first frost, and one likes to wait it out till spring)
